Module 1: Columns and Tables This module explains how to divide documents into columns; use tab stops; and create, convert, and format tables.
Lessons • Presenting Information in Columns • Creating a Tabular List • Presenting Information in a Table • Formatting Table Information • Performing Calculations in a Table
Lab : Columns and Tables • Divide a document into columns and format the columns and text. • Enter text separated by tabs and set custom tab stops. • Create, convert, and format tables. • Create a quick table and format table content. • Calculate information in a table, and copy, link and enter data in an Excel object
After completing this module, students will be able to: • Flow text in multiple columns. • Use tabs to simulate tables. • Create tables and enter and format table information. • Summarize the information in a table by performing calculations. • Insert Excel data in a document.
Module 2: Diagrams This module explains how to create and modify diagrams.
Lessons • Creating a Diagram • Modifying a Diagram
Lab : Diagrams • Create and position a diagram. • Add shapes and text to a diagram, and change the diagram layout.
After completing this module, students will be able to: • Create organization charts, flowcharts, and other business diagrams. • Update a diagram's information or change its formatting.
Module 3: Charts This module explains how to create and modify a chart, and use information in Excel in the chart.
Lessons • Inserting a Chart • Modifying a Chart • Using Existing Data in a Chart
Lab : Charts • Add a chart to a document. • Modify the appearance of a chart and save it as a template. • Copy Excel data into a chart’s worksheet, and expand the data range to plot all the data.
After completing this module, students will be able to: • Plot data as a chart. • Change the chart's elements, and create a template for future charts. • Use data from an Excel worksheet to plot a chart in Word.
Module 4: Other Visual Elements This module explains how to enhance documents by dressing up text, how to insert symbols and equations, and draw and modify shapes.
Lessons • Creating Fancy Text • Inserting Symbols and Equations • Formatting the First Letter of a Paragraph • Drawing and Modifying Shapes
Lab : Other Visual Elements • Create and modify a WordArt object. • Insert a graphical icon, and add an equation to the Equation gallery. • Apply a drop cap. • Draw and manipulate shapes on a canvas.
After completing this module, students will be able to: • Use WordArt objects to dress up text. • Insert symbols, and build equations. • Make the first letter of a paragraph stand out. • Use shapes for emphasis, decoration, or to draw simple pictures.
Module 5: Page Layout This module explains how to add headers and footers, change the relationship of elements on the page, and use a table to control page layout.
Lessons • Adding Headers and Footers • Changing the Relationship of Elements on the Page • Using a Table to Control Page Layout
Lab : Page Layout • Add a header and footer to a document, with a different header for the first page. • Modify the text-wrapping, position, and stacking order of pictures. • Draw a table, and insert and format nested tables.
After completing this module, students will be able to: • Repeat information on designated pages of a document • Change how elements on a page relate to one another • Insert information in the cells of a table to position them precisely on the page
